Water Temperature in Orta San Giulio: General Trends and Swimming Opportunities

Orta San Giulio, located on the eastern shore of Lake Orta in Piedmont, is a picturesque town offering stunning views and a peaceful atmosphere. The water temperature near the town varies seasonally, creating opportunities for different types of activities. In summer, the lake’s surface temperature typically ranges from 72°F to 78°F (22°C to 26°C), making it an ideal spot for swimming and relaxing by the water. The clear, calm waters near Orta San Giulio are inviting for both locals and visitors.

During spring and early autumn, the water remains cooler, ranging between 60°F and 68°F (16°C to 20°C). While swimming might appeal to those comfortable with cooler temperatures, these conditions are perfect for kayaking, paddleboarding, or simply enjoying the scenic beauty. In winter, the water temperature drops below 50°F (10°C), making it too cold for swimming but offering a serene ambiance ideal for walking along the shore or taking in the breathtaking views of the lake and surrounding mountains.

Orta San Giulio has several access points to Lake Orta for swimming, including small public beaches and private areas managed by local accommodations. The tranquil setting and pristine water quality make it a favorite for those seeking a quiet and relaxing lakeside retreat.

What is the water temperature in Orta San Giulio during the summer months?

The average water temperature in Orta San Giulio during the summer months is typically between 65°F to 71°F (19°C to 21°C), and it can reach up to 75°F (24°C) at its warmest. However, in some years, the temperature may exceed this range.

What is the water temperature in Orta San Giulio in May?

The average water temperature in Orta San Giulio in May ranges from 46°F to 70°F (8°C to 21°C).

What is the water temperature in Orta San Giulio in September?

The average water temperature in Orta San Giulio in September is typically between 52°F to 66°F (11°C to 19°C).

Is it possible to swim in the Lake Orta in Orta San Giulio, and what are the available options for doing so?

Yes, it is possible to swim in Lake Orta in Orta San Giulio. You can enjoy swimming at public beaches, private lidos, or directly from a boat in designated areas.
